    the "orange rim"/ core will make for a rougher ride than the bumballs, which have a small core.

    it all depends on thane depth, the less than, the rougher the ride, the more thane, the more its gonna absorb the road a little.

    if you wanna drift more, get the flys, if you wanna grip more get the gumballs.

    Gumballs have lasted my friend 2 years of hard riding. and he has the 76a ones (regrets getting such a soft wheel) he is not into sliding (he does some speed checking), or DH (he like to bomb, but its more Balls than Skills).

    another friend has the 76 flys, buy he just uses them to cruise.

    the advantage of the flywheel is that is is lighter, and quicker. the disadvantages is there is less thane on the core, less meat on them bones. its not as plush a ride. they do slide easier, cuz they're radiused. the Gumballs will slide quite nicely once broken in.

    for the most bang for your buck, get some Gumballs. you will be happier in the long haul. then later on get the 83mm flys.
